ABOUT Walter P. Laufenberg

Walter P. Laufenberg has devoted the majority of his thirty plus years of practice to the courtroom where he has tried over one-hundred cases, both civil and criminal, before a jury. Most recently he attained an acquittal on behalf of his client who was indicted for vehicular homicide. Mr. Laufenberg’s trial experience makes him a venerable advocate as well as a seasoned professional able to navigate the litigation process to the best advantage of his client.
